I'm taking a headcount of who is running what gearing. We are about to put in the production order later this week and I need to know what gearing in what quantity to order. We can't get all the options in on the first order so I wanna cover the basics for the MT, TT, and XB. I'm assuming the XT will run the same gears as the TT. For those of you running the XT please post your comments.

When you switch to the 29/31's is that because you are running Bowties instead of the MT tires?

TerraKill said:
and a one peice final shaft(the shaft brakes sit on) if avaliable? =) can we have any hints to a rough price of what we are looking at for the 2 speed?
You won't need a one-piece layshaft anymore. I have duel 22mm bearings in the gearplate to support the layshaft. It's rock solid now.

Also, we are looking at $270ish +/-$20. We are making a few more changes so I can't get an exact price for another week.

Ron E said:
on my obr full mod 35cc tt i run 29/31 and switch to 31/29 once in a while... but mainly 29/31 with bowties... i cant wait for a 2 speed = :eek: :D
Ur gonna want a 37/19 gear set. 1st speed is like 29/31/25/25 but the 2nd speed is faster than a 31/29/25/25. It's more like a 32/28 if this gear even existed. Well now it does lol :)
